Tree canopy thinning services involve selectively reducing the density and size of tree branches and foliage to improve overall tree health and safety. This process typically includes removing dead, damaged, or overcrowded limbs to promote better airflow and sunlight penetration through the canopy. By carefully thinning the branches, property owners can help prevent issues such as limb failure, storm damage, and overgrowth that may interfere with structures or power lines. Professionals use specialized techniques to ensure the tree’s natural shape is maintained while addressing specific concerns related to its size and density.
Addressing common problems like overgrown or densely packed canopies, tree thinning services are often sought to mitigate risks associated with falling branches or entire trees during storms. Overcrowded foliage can also lead to poor air circulation, which may increase the likelihood of pest infestations or disease. Additionally, excessive shade caused by thick canopies can hinder grass and plant growth underneath. Thinning the canopy can enhance visibility, reduce potential hazards, and improve the overall health of the tree by reducing stress caused by excessive weight and crowded branches.

The overview below groups typical Tree Canopy Thinning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Scarsdale, NY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Initial Assessment - The cost for evaluating a tree canopy thinning project typically 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the trees involved. Larger or more complex assessments may incur higher fees.
Basic Thinning Service - Basic canopy thinning services usually cost between $300 and $800 per tree. Prices vary based on tree height, density, and accessibility for equipment.
Advanced Thinning and Cleanup - For more extensive thinning and debris removal, costs generally fall between $1,000 and $3,000 for larger properties or multiple trees. Additional charges may apply for difficult access or specialty equipment.
Maintenance and Follow-up - Ongoing maintenance or periodic thinning services can range from $200 to $600 per visit, depending on the scope and number of trees needing care. Service providers may offer package deals for multiple sessions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is tree canopy thinning? Tree canopy thinning involves selectively removing branches to reduce the density of a tree's foliage, improving air circulation and light penetration.
Why consider tree canopy thinning? Thinning can help maintain tree health, prevent overgrowth, and reduce the risk of branch failure or storm damage.
How do professionals perform canopy thinning? Experienced service providers evaluate the tree's structure and carefully prune selected branches to ensure the tree's stability and health.
When is the best time for canopy thinning? The ideal time for thinning is typically during the dormant season or when the tree is not actively growing.
